: I used the CD on another machine at work, and it works just fine. Can |
13 |
: you tell me how to turn the logging on for the dhcpcd? This way I can |
14 |
: try and get a better handle on where the failure occurs and ask more |
15 |
: informed questions. |
16 |
|
17 |
Use the "-d" flag for debug. This should throw out copious amounts of |
18 |
information. In addition to "-d" you may want to use the "-T" flag for |
19 |
test mode. It'll show you what's supposed to happen, but won't actually |
20 |
change anything (not like it matters right now, but for future |
21 |
edification). |
